Competitors perform acrobatics on the maypole in Rottenstuben, Germany, 10 June 2019. Climbing the village’s 25-meter-high may pole has a 47-year-tradition and is said to have been started by young men looking to impress women. The competition is held in two disciplines: speed and acrobatics.

A participant on wooden skis and in vintage clothing speeds down the slope during the 'Nostalski' nostalgia ski race in Kruen, Germany, 13 January 2018. During the fun-oriented event, racers face a parcours with special tasks such as clearing various obstacles and drinking schnaps mid-race.

Competitors face off in the German Finger Wrestling Championships (Fingerhakeln) in Garmisch-Partenkirchen, southern Germany, 15 August 2019. The sport pits two competitors matched in age and weight who sit at a specially-designed table across from one another and pull at a small leather band with one finger until one player has pulled the other across. The sport is traditional in Bavaria and Austria and dates back to the 17th century.
